BTS sells out all three shows in Tampa, USA... 190,000 fans cheer



The 'BTS WORLD TOUR ARIRANG IN NORTH AMERICA' concert held by BTS in Tampa, USA, sold out three consecutive shows, attracting approximately 190,000 attendees.

The tour took place on the 25th, 26th, and 28th (local time) at Raymond James Stadium, and despite being the first U.S. performance in four years, it received an enthusiastic response. Fans practiced wave cheers while waiting for the opening and passionately participated throughout the concert by shouting the cheering methods. The stage started with "Hooligan" from the fifth full album "ARIRANG," followed by "MIC Drop," "FAKE LOVE," and "NORMAL." Especially during the "Body to Body" stage, when the Korean folk song "Arirang" played, the audience joined in singing together, creating a symbolic moment.

Another feature of the concert was the "random song" segment. The members selected songs on the spot based on audience requests and the atmosphere, presenting different performances at each show. At the Tampa concert, "Boy With Luv (Feat. Halsey)" and "Pied Piper" were performed, and when the intro of "Pied Piper" started, an explosive cheer erupted.

Jin shared his thoughts near the end of the concert, saying, "I felt this during the last 'Run, Seokjin' tour as well, but Tampa is truly the best. I strongly recommended to the members that they must come here with that feeling. After this concert, I don't regret that decision." The members said, "We were a bit worried since this was the first show of the North American tour, but thanks to all of you, all our worries disappeared. You made the start of the North American tour the best, so we look forward to the upcoming concerts even more." They also added, "We really love you and missed you so much. This moment right now made me realize that this is the reason I have lived until now," and "Tampa changed my tempo."

After the Tampa concert, BTS will continue performing at El Paso Sun Bowl Stadium on May 2nd and 3rd, becoming the first Korean artist to do so. The El Paso County Commission awarded BTS the 'Estimado Amigo' award and approved a resolution declaring May 2nd and 3rd as 'El Paso BTS Weekend.' Following this, 31 concerts are scheduled in 12 cities including Mexico City, Stanford, and Las Vegas.
